sensor

Example

The sensor detected a change in temperature and activated the cooling system. [sensor: noun]

Example

The security system uses sensors to detect any movement in the house. [sensors: plural noun]

transducer

Example

The transducer converts electrical signals into sound waves for ultrasound imaging. [transducer: noun]

Example

The guitar pickup is a type of transducer that converts string vibrations into electrical signals. [transducer: noun]

Which word is more common?

Sensor is more commonly used than transducer in everyday language. Sensor is a versatile term that covers a wide range of applications, while transducer is a more technical term used in specific fields such as engineering and physics.

What’s the difference in the tone of formality between sensor and transducer?

Transducer is a more technical and formal term compared to sensor. Sensor is more commonly used in everyday language and can be employed in both formal and informal contexts.
